The PC servers for the Dark Souls games have now been offline for over 100 days. Back in January, we reported a security issue with the online multiplayer functionality of FromSoftware’s Souls games that would allow invaders to run code on someone else’s PC without permission. Publisher Bandai Namco shut down the servers, meaning PC players are unable to play the games online - a key part of the experience through invasions, summoning, and messages....

Dead Island Epidemic Is Being Shut Down

Free-to-play MOBA Dead Island Epidemic is closing down next month, Deep Silver has announced. The game’s servers will remain live until October 15, after which the game will be gone for good. If you’ve still got any currency left, Deep Silver will be offering a “very large discount on all characters and boosts to give everyone a chance to spend any remaining currency on characters and items you may have wanted to try before, but never did”....

Dead Rising Case Zero Case West Not Included In Ps4 Xbox One Remasters

Dead Rising: Case Zero and Dead Rising: Case West will not be included in the upcoming PS4 and Xbox One remasters, Capcom has confirmed. The publisher confirmed the news on Twitter, where it stated that there are “no plans for those at this point”. Case Zero and Cast West originally launched as downloadable games either side of Dead Rising 2’s release, with Case Zero leading into the events of the sequel, and Case West set following the game’s conclusion....

Destiny 2 S The Witch Queen Expansion Delayed Into Early 2022

Bungie has announced that it will be delaying this year’s Destiny 2 expansion, entitled The Witch Queen, into early next year. In the studio’s latest update to the community, Assistant Game Director Joe Blackburn revealed that, following the successful launch of Destiny 2: Beyond Light late last year, the team looked at its plans to finish off the current story arc which kicked off in that expansion with the next two chapters The Witch Queen and Lightfall and “made the difficult but important decision to move its release to early 2022; we also realized we needed to add an additional unannounced chapter after Lightfall to fully complete our first saga of Destiny....

Destiny S Iron Banner Returns On April 28

Destiny’s Iron Banner will finally make a return on April 28 with the weekly server refresh, Bungie has announced. Many expected the Iron Banner to return sooner, but Bungie has said the reason for the delay is to give players time to adjust to the changes in to the Crucible following the recent 1.1.2 update. Players should also note that due to a navigation bug, the Iron Banner won’t be visible in the Tower or the Crucible menu, but will have to be accessed via the main Director Interface....

Callisto Protocol Developer Confirms 60 Fps Performance Mode

The Callisto Protocol publisher Krafton has confirmed a 60 FPS performance mode for the game, just days after Gotham Knights hit the headlines for not having one on consoles. Responding last night to some confusion over the game’s release date, the official Callisto Protocol account on Twitter reconfirmed the space survival horror’s 2nd December launch. “And yes, we’ll have a 60 FPS performance mode,” the tweet added. The news Gotham Knights will be locked to 30 FPS on P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X/S raised eyebrows earlier this week - coming just days before its arrival this Friday....
